MediaWiki vs ProofHub: The Verdict

⚡ Summary:

MediaWiki: MediaWiki is a free and open-source wiki software platform written in PHP. It serves as the platform for Wikipedia and other Wikimedia projects, allowing users to collaboratively create and edit content.

ProofHub: ProofHub is an online project management and collaboration software. It helps teams plan projects, assign tasks, track progress, and collaborate on work. Key features include task lists, Gantt charts, discussions, time tracking, and document management.

Key Features Comparison

MediaWiki
MediaWiki Features
  • Wiki markup for content creation
  • Version control of pages
  • Customizable permissions
  • Multilingual support
  • Extensible through extensions
  • WYSISYG and raw HTML editing
  • Full text search
  • Categories and tags
ProofHub
ProofHub Features
  • Project management
  • Task management
  • Gantt charts
  • Time tracking
  • Discussions
  • Documents
  • Calendars

Pros & Cons Analysis

MediaWiki
MediaWiki

Pros

  • Free and open source
  • Widely used and supported
  • Strong community
  • Highly customizable
  • Supports large wikis with high traffic
  • Robust permissions system

Cons

  • Steep learning curve for wiki markup
  • Potential performance issues on large wikis
  • Upgrades can be complex
  • Limited WYSIWYG editing features
  • No built-in user management system
ProofHub
ProofHub

Pros

  • Intuitive interface
  • Robust features
  • Good value for money
  • Smooth workflows
  • Great for remote teams

Cons

  • Can be pricey for large teams
  • Mobile app needs work
  • Steep learning curve
  • No free version
